WISCONSINAndrew Grandatall Taken From Jail by aMob and Hung.Viroqua, W is., June 1.—Andrew Grandstaff was captured while in bed last night by a Pinkerton detective aud two local officers. Today the detectives pumped a lull confession out of him He intended to rob old man Drake, but was unable to make him disclose the place where the family valuables were hid. Thi9 led to his killing. Mrs. Drakeattempted to shoot Grandstaff and bekilled her iu the presence of her children. To prevent the little ones trom telling, he cut their throats. Grandstaff has been known as an ignorant but cunning and daring semi-desperado. Hehas been a participant in several affrays and the associate of hard characters. V ery little is known of his antecedents only that he was of illegitimate birth. As people were greatly excited, aud lynching was threatened, troops were promptlyordered out by Governor Rusk.At a late hour tonight one thousand determined men surrounded the jail, but the authorities refused to give up the prisoner. rIhe barricades were then overpowered. An hour was spent in breaking down the steel cage and then the prisoner fought with desperate furyagaiust all who sought to euter. The struggle did not last long, and he was taken out, bound band and foot, led to the porch below and there preparations were made to hang him. A rope was placed around his neck and the prisoner was asked what he had to say. He protested his innocence, but it was knowu that he had .made a lull confes sion in the afternoon, and he was not believed. At midnight the scene at the jail was horrible. The prisoner was covered with blood,having been terribly mangled while the steel cage was being battered down. He stood with a halter around his neck pleading for his life.At 12:45 the mol) hung the prisoner to a tree in front of the court house and then let him down to see if he would confess.Later—Grandstaff refused to make a confession to the lynchers and after som% time they strung him up again. When lowered the second time he wasdead.
